What Soft Washing Is and Why It Matters

Soft washing uses low water pressure paired with targeted cleaning solutions to lift organic growth and grime. It’s designed for delicate surfaces that can be damaged by a blast of water, especially stucco, vinyl, and painted wood. Picture it like treating a stain on your favorite shirt: you don’t scrub holes into the fabric, you break down the stain and rinse it away.

On Florida’s Gulf Coast, where algae and mildew thrive, soft washing cleans the source of the problem instead of smearing it around. That means the results last longer, and your exterior finishes stay intact.

Why Stucco Needs a Gentle Touch

Stucco looks solid, but it’s porous. Water can be pushed into hairline cracks, weep holes, and seams when high pressure is used. That moisture doesn’t evaporate fast in our climate and may lead to bubbling paint or interior leaks. **Never use high pressure on stucco.** Soft washing gets a thorough clean without forcing water where it shouldn’t go.

Vinyl and Painted Siding: Clean, Don’t Carve

Vinyl can warp or etch under high pressure. Painted fiber cement and wood can lose paint, exposing raw material to salt and sun. Soft washing has the reach and chemistry to remove algae around trim, soffits, and porch ceilings without scarring the surface. It also leaves fewer “tiger stripes” at lap joints and under windows.

Surfaces That Are Ideal for Soft Washing

  • Stucco and EIFS
  • Vinyl, aluminum, and painted wood siding
  • Asphalt shingle roofs and many metal roofs
  • Screened enclosures and painted soffits
  • Decorative stone, columns, and trim

By using low pressure, these materials get the clean they need without pitting, gouging, or peel lines.

House Washing vs. Pressure Washing: What’s the Difference?

Traditional pressure washing in Fort Walton Beach relies on force. House washing is a service approach where the right method is chosen for each surface. True house washing often starts with a soft wash for siding and stucco, and then uses higher pressure only on hard surfaces that can handle it, like many driveways. That way, you’re not treating your home like a sidewalk.

Signs Your Home Needs Soft Washing Now

  • Dark vertical lines under windows, vents, or soffits
  • Chalky film on painted stucco or fading on vinyl laps
  • Green or black patches on shaded walls and porch ceilings
  • Rusty drips from fasteners or irrigation overspray stains
